Valeria F. Leasa

Valeria
F. Leasa, age 84, passed away on March 16, 2015 at Sterling House of Fond du
Lac.  She was born July 2, 1930 in the
town of Byron, a daughter of the late August and Florence (Wietor) Rose and was
united in marriage to William J. Leasa on August 26, 1950.  In 1963, they formed W.J. Leasa Electric,
Inc. and worked together for many years serving the Fond du Lac area.
Valeria and Bill enjoyed
spending time with family and neighbors at their cottage in Mt. Morris, WI.  “Larry,” as Valeria was known to friends and
family, also enjoyed bowling and gardening, but most of all, loved the time she
spent with her children and grandchildren. 
She will be dearly missed by all who knew her.
